Transaction 58568c75c881bad3141cb7f2c137093dc659d633da8ea2395d98586788b21376

1 Input
2 Outputs
  • 58568c75c881bad3141cb7f2c137093dc659d633da8ea2395d98586788b21376:0
  • value  413413
    address  16UKxPSViX3urhiwEGH638wyTyBY2rBGSv
  • 58568c75c881bad3141cb7f2c137093dc659d633da8ea2395d98586788b21376:1
  • value  15347766
    address  bc1qtukmdqdx4vwhpzqz3ygfek5jhc25c2gt9pmwj5